#8177 Nightly test failure in test_webui/test_netgroup.py::test_netgroup::test_unsaved_changes
Closed: worksforme 3 years ago by stsymbal. Opened 4 years ago by frenaud.

The nightly test testing-fedora/test_webui_host_net_groups failed in test_webui/test_netgroup.py::test_netgroup::test_unsaved_changes. Logs available in PR #120 at the following llocation

Test logs:

self = <ipatests.test_webui.test_netgroup.test_netgroup object at 0x7f008ad68210>

    @screenshot
    def test_unsaved_changes(self):
        """
        verifying unsaved changes dialog ticket#2075
        """
        self.init_app()
        self.add_record(netgroup.ENTITY, netgroup.DATA8,
                        dialog_btn='add_and_edit')
        mod_description = (netgroup.DATA8['mod'][0][2])

        # verifying Cancel button
        self.fill_fields(netgroup.DATA8['mod'])
        self.click_on_link('Netgroups')
        self.assert_dialog()
        self.dialog_button_click('cancel')
        self.assert_facet_button_enabled('save')

        # verifying Revert button
        self.click_on_link('Netgroups')
        self.assert_dialog()
        self.dialog_button_click('revert')
        self.navigate_to_record(netgroup.PKEY8)
        self.verify_btn_action(mod_description)

        # verifying Save button
        self.fill_fields(netgroup.DATA8['mod'])
        self.click_on_link('Netgroups')
        self.assert_dialog()
>       self.dialog_button_click('save')

test_webui/test_netgroup.py:209: 
_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 
test_webui/ui_driver.py:705: in dialog_button_click
    self._button_click(s, dialog, name)
_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 

self = <ipatests.test_webui.test_netgroup.test_netgroup object at 0x7f008ad68210>
selector = ".rcue-dialog-buttons button[name='save']"
parent = <selenium.webdriver.firefox.webelement.FirefoxWebElement (session="81f9d6ff-92c4-4584-8f7b-0b47077b0781", element="010112ca-c3e2-4217-9737-088ac8304c6a")>
name = 'save'

    def _button_click(self, selector, parent, name=''):
        btn = self.find(selector, By.CSS_SELECTOR, parent, strict=True)
        self.move_to_element_in_page(btn)
        disabled = btn.get_attribute("disabled")
>       assert btn.is_displayed(), 'Button is not displayed: %s' % name
E       AssertionError: Button is not displayed: save

test_webui/ui_driver.py:736: AssertionError

The test suite currently is pretty stable in all branches (master, ipa-4-6, ipa-4-8).

Metadata Update from @stsymbal:
- Issue close_status updated to: worksforme
- Issue status updated to: Closed (was: Open)

3 years ago

Login to comment on this ticket.

Metadata